Master The Ultimate Guide to Applying Makeup Foundation with a Sponge
Applying foundation with a sponge can result in a flawless and natural complexion. This approach allows for buildable coverage, making it perfect for all skin complexions.
Here's a step-by-step guide to obtain a flawless foundation application with a sponge:
- Start by prepping your complexion with moisturizer and primer. This creates a smooth base for your foundation.
- Squeeze a small amount of foundation onto the back of your hand.
- Activate your sponge with water and pat out any excess. A damp sponge helps for a even application.
- Pat the foundation onto your skin in a upward motion, starting from the center of your face and spreading outwards.
- Blend the edges of your foundation with your fingers. This creates a seamless transition between your foundation and your skin.
Remember to apply sheer layers of foundation and layer coverage as needed. Finally, set your makeup with a finishing spray for long-lasting.
Picking the Perfect Makeup Foundation for Your Skin Kind
Finding the ideal foundation can feel overwhelming with all the choices available. Your skin type is a crucial element when making your selection. If you have oily skin, look for a velvet finish foundation that helps control shine. For dehydrated skin, choose a hydrating formula with ingredients like hyaluronic acid or glycerin. Combination skin prefers from a foundation that balances both coverage and hydration.
A good foundation should fuse seamlessly into your skin, providing an even tone without looking heavy. Try different formulas until you find the perfect match for your unique skin.
Brush vs. Sponge: Choosing Your Ideal Foundation Tool
When it comes to applying your foundation flawlessly, the choice between a sponge and a brush can be tricky. Both tools offer different advantages and outcomes, so finding the perfect match for your skin type and desired look is key.
- Sponges, known for their plushness, excel at creating a airbrushed finish. They're great for diffusing liquid and cream foundations easily.
- Brushes, on the other hand, offer more accuracy and can be applied to achieve a range of finishes from subtle to intense. They're especially suited for powder foundations.
Ultimately, the perfect tool for you rests on your desired outcome. Don't be afraid to try different options and see what works greatest for your skin and makeup goals.
